September 1, 201511 yr Per a media inquiry on Friday, August 28, MSU President Wayne D. Andrews issued the following statement: "Morehead State University has consistently demonstrated our support for inclusion and diversity. We will continue to celebrate our commonalities and learn from one another¹s differences. On the issue of same-sex marriage, the United States Supreme Court, the Governor of the Commonwealth of Kentucky, and the 6th Circuit Court of Appeals have all spoken. We believe elected officials should obey the law and do their jobs. It would be up to the Kentucky General Assembly to change those responsibilities." Dr. Wayne D. Andrews, President Morehead State University
September 1, 201511 yr MOREHEAD Embattled Rowan County Clerk Kim Davis shows up for work early Tuesday morning at the Rowan County Courthouse. Late Monday night the Supreme Court ruled against Davis in her latest appeal in the same-sex marriage license issue. Davis could face jail time or fines if she refuses to offer marriage licenses today. Rowan clerk comes to work early on decision day - The Independent Online: News
